Output ef26c60a57009ea97e68e30302d4dd3a293ef3cf6a263b62f83d3dbaf9c94ebd:1
- value
- 6973546897585
- script pubkey
- OP_0 OP_PUSHBYTES_20 a660c1a88327562224aa66f23f502f1c7a7adbf1
- address
- tb1q5esvr2yryatzyf92vmer75p0r3a84kl3yrzy7m
- transaction
- ef26c60a57009ea97e68e30302d4dd3a293ef3cf6a263b62f83d3dbaf9c94ebd
- confirmations
- 174086
- spent
- true